    I joined the Slammer Tour in 2004 and became addicted in 2005 when I played in 40 events. Last year I played in 44 - and would have been there more had I not had to interrupt my golf season to get married in late June.

    The Slammer Tour is a ladder-style match play golf league. You earn your position (or ranking) based on who you have beaten. I'm ranked somewhere in the mid-20's right now and if you come out and beat me in the first event, you'll take my spot and knock me down one.

    There are golfers of all skill levels - a handful of those who can shoot in the mid to high 70's, a whole bunch who hover in the low to mid-80's, a good group in the high 80's or 90's, and a number of 100+ golfers. There will always be players on hand who will be available to play at a certain skill level.

    Events are usually on Tuesday and Wednesday afternoons, on weekend mornings and/or afternoons and on holidays as well.

    It's lots of fun and I regret having waited a couple years to check it out after a friend of mine told me about it. It's a good bunch of guys.
